Dr. Joan Sullivan specializes in orthopedic surgery with additional expertise in hand surgery. She earned her medical degree from George Washington University School of Medicine & Health Sciences and completed her residency at United States Army Medical Center. With 43 years of experience in the field, Dr. Sullivan has built extensive knowledge in treating complex musculoskeletal conditions.

Dr. Sullivan practices at Madigan Army Medical Center and Madigan Healthcare System in Tacoma, Washington. She focuses on treating cervical disc disease, carpal tunnel syndrome, and rotator cuff disorders. Her expertise includes performing spinal X-rays to diagnose bone and joint problems.
